Fluid Power Forum Explores Groundbreaking Research Regarding Incorporation of Electrification in Hydraulic Off-Road Equipment

Episode 61 of Fluid Power Forum, NFPA’s fluid power industry-focused podcast, is now live. This episode features Kanok Boriboonsomsin of UC Riverside. Listen below to hear the exclusive discussion about UC Riverside’s yet-to-be-published research on the readiness of off-highway hydraulic equipment to incorporate electric power as their prime mover.
